Lady Trojans finish 2-3 at tournament
The Hillsboro Lady Trojans volleyball team is off to a 5-8 start, competing in Saturday’s Southeast of Saline Tournament in Gypsum.
Against teams from Classes 3, 4, and 5A, the Trojans were able to post a 2-3 finish.
Saturday got off to a good start against Smoky Valley with the Trojans dispatching the Vikings in two sets.
In the Trojan War against host SES, Hillsboro was unable to keep it going, tumbling by a pair of 25-23 scores.
Class 4A’s Concordia handed the Trojans their second setback of the day with the Lady Panthers prevailing in 25-15 and 25-16 sets.
Hillsboro bounced back in the fourth match, upending Class 5A Salina South in two sets, 25-16, and 25-17.
The day ended on a sour note in another battle of Trojans, with Beloit claiming two 25-17 wins.
On deck after a Tuesday triangular at Hillsboro against Halstead, and Life Prep, the Trojans return to action Sept. 19 in the Nickerson triangular.
